Where are you guys finding it best to put the GPS antenna? My car didn't come with nav so I'm using the antenna that came bundled with my Avin unit and I've mounted the antenna right in the corner of the dash on the passenger side. You can't see the cable at all, just the GPS module so it isn't too bad. Seems to be picking up my location alright but I haven't tested it much yet.
Just wondering if anyone has any better suggestions as to whether it can be tucked out of the way or I'm better off just leaving it where it is. |

Although I don't have AVIN specifically, we have the same antennas. I mounted my antenna in-between the bottom right corner of the center speaker and top right corner of the head unit (screen). Space is EXTREMELY tight and a sum-bitch to get to (left behind some DNA from my left hand). Before mounting, I first affixed velcro to the spot I felt was best, then fixed velcro to the antenna itself...felt if I ever needed to move, I could easily remove antenna and remount onto new velcro strip. .

I finally got around to actually driving my car today to try the GPS out. With Google Maps everything seems to be ok - location seems to be accurate and everything is as I'd expect. With TomTom Go it seems to be a mess, it works for a while then seems to lose track of where I am and then it works again but it basically renders it useless.
I installed GPS Status & Toolbox to keep tabs on what was going on while driving around and it seemed to have a stable and reliable GPS signal so it seems it's TomTom's fault rather than the Avin unit's or the GPS antenna. Anyone else use TomTom Go on theirs and had any similar issues? |
